Railroad Pub & Pizza

Burlington, WA

Railroad Pub & Pizza does not specifically accommodate vegans, but they offer some options that can likely be made vegan, such as the House Salad and the Cranberry Cashew Salad.

Top Picks

Veggie Train

Provolone cheese, arugula, roasted tomato, avocado, and red onion. Served with our house-made jalapeño artichoke dip spread and balsamic glaze.

Cranberry Cashew Salad

Arugula, spring mix, Brussels sprouts, carrots, basil, Craisins, and feta. Tossed with honey mustard dressing. Topped with crisp apples and cashews.

House Salad

Spring leaf mix topped with cucumber, carrots, and cherry tomato. Served with your choice of house-made lemon dill vinaigrette, blue cheese, ranch, or honey mustard dressing.
